The Vader Project

100 of the best underground artists and designers

were given a scale Darth Vader helmet to customize as they wanted.







I spy a Spy VS. Spy one on the right!

On display until May 3rd @ the Andy Warhol Museum in Pittsburgh.

Coming Soon

___


Johnny Depp as The Mad Hatter

Anne Hathaway as The White Queen

Michael Sheen as The White Rabbit

Helena Bonham Carter as The Red Queen

Alan Rickman as The Caterpillar

Mia Wasikowska as Alice

Crispin Glover as The Knave of Hearts

Stephen Fry as The Cheshire Cat

Christopher Lee as The Jabberwock

Timothy Spall as The Bloodhound

Matt Lucas as Tweedledee / Tweedledum

Noah Taylor as The March Hare

Eleanor Tomlinson as Fiona Chataway



DIRECTED BY: TIM BURTON (!)
